  • The Science Behind the Modern Sales Professional [INFOGRAPHIC]

    The sales process has dramatically changed since the arrival of search engines and social media. According to a report by CEB, 57% of buying decisions are already made before there is any interaction between a buyer and a sales rep. Another study by Harvard Business Review reported that 90% of C-level executives never respond to cold calls or email blasts.

  • Killing Unicorns: Putting Sky-High Startup Valuations into Perspective

    We have all seen statements such as "Uber is worth four times more than Hertz, and it doesn't own a single car." While there is a kernel of truth to this statement -- Uber's latest round valued the company at $40B while Hertz's current market capitalization is $10B -- the difference between startup valuations (so-called "unicorns" with valuations of $1 billion or more) and publicly held companies' market capitalization is so profound that the two are hardly comparable. Understanding the distinction is vital if we want to cut through hype, understand risk and assess the market changes underway.

  • The Peer-to-Peer Economy Is Growing

    One of the most obvious places we see P2P integrated into traditional businesses is customer support. Knowledgeable customers typically provide better, more relevant, and more current help to one another for free than any set of highly paid experts. So nurturing your customers, acknowledging and rewarding them for the free service they provide, is well worth the care and attention required to keep them happy and contributing.
